Von Decarlo Movies
- 2022
Salesmen
Salesmen6.32022HD
Four door-to-door salesmen struggle to get by while pursuing an analog profession in a digital world. They unwittingly begin selling propaganda for a...
- 2005
The Interpreter
The Interpreter6.3062005HD
After Silvia Broome, an interpreter at United Nations headquarters, overhears plans of an assassination, an American Secret Service agent is sent to i...